MemU vs Spider Cloud
Side-by-side comparison of features, pricing, and ratings
At a glance
| Dimension | MemU | Spider Cloud |
|---|---|---|
| Pricing | Freemium with contact-based pricing; token-based consumption | Freemium with paid plans starting at $49/mo for 10,000 credits; AI Studio $6/mo add-on |
| Core Function | Agentic memory framework with proactive intention prediction | Web crawling, scraping, and search API for AI agents |
| Key Feature | Three-layer hierarchical memory with non-embedding LLM retrieval | Browser AI commands (Act/Extract/Observe) via WebSocket (Mar 2026) |
| Integrations | GPT-4.1-mini, DeepSeek-v3.1, Gemini-3-Flash, Claude, Amazon Bedrock | LangChain, LlamaIndex, CrewAI, FlowiseAI, data connectors (S3, GCS, etc.) |
| Best For | 24/7 autonomous agents with persistent memory; intention prediction | RAG pipelines needing real-time web data; high-volume scraping |
| Open Source | Self-hosted options (memU, memU-server, memU-ui) | Core available on GitHub |
Spider Cloud and MemU serve entirely different needs. If you need to feed fresh web data into AI agents or RAG pipelines, Spider Cloud’s low-cost scraping ($0.03/1K pages) and new Browser AI commands make it the clear choice. If your AI agent needs persistent memory that predicts user intentions and operates 24/7 autonomously, MemU’s three-layer memory architecture is purpose-built for that. Choose based on whether your bottleneck is data ingestion or memory persistence.

Who should pick which
- Solo founder building an AI assistant with RAGPick: Spider Cloud
Spider Cloud’s low-cost scraping ($0.03/1K pages) and Browser AI commands allow easy ingestion of web data for RAG. Its scraper catalog and data connectors simplify setup. Pay-as-you-go pricing suits small budgets.
- Developer creating a 24/7 customer support agentPick: MemU
MemU’s persistent memory and proactive intention prediction enable the agent to remember user history and act autonomously. Its three-layer memory ensures traceable reasoning, ideal for support.
- Team needing high-volume scraping for AI training dataPick: Spider Cloud
Spider Cloud’s Rust engine delivers fast, reliable scraping at $0.03 per 1K pages. The new Browser AI commands and 1,000+ scraper examples reduce development time. Data connectors streamline pipeline export.
- AI companion developer needing long-term memoryPick: MemU
MemU’s multimodal memory (text, image, audio, video) and intention prediction create a lifelike companion that remembers and anticipates user needs. Self-hosted options provide privacy.
- Enterprise building agentic workflow with web contextPick: Spider Cloud
Spider Cloud integrates with LangChain, LlamaIndex, and CrewAI. Its data connectors (S3, GCS, etc.) feed directly into enterprise storage. Browser AI commands allow interactive web automation.

Can Spider Cloud be used for real-time web data in AI agents?
Yes, Spider Cloud provides a web crawling/scraping API with a search endpoint for query-based retrieval. The new Browser AI commands (Act, Extract, Observe) via WebSocket enable real-time interaction with pages.
Does MemU support multimodal inputs?
Yes, MemU ingests text, image, audio, and video, and organizes them into its three-layer memory hierarchy.
Which tool is better for RAG pipelines?
Spider Cloud is better for feeding external web data into RAG pipelines due to its low-cost, high-speed scraping and integrations with LangChain and LlamaIndex.
Which tool offers open-source self-hosting?
Both: Spider Cloud's core is on GitHub; MemU offers memU, memU-server, and memU-ui for self-hosting.
How does Browser AI commands work in Spider Cloud?
Launched in March 2026, send AI commands via WebSocket: Act (click, type, navigate), Extract (pull structured data), and Observe (describe screen). Requires an AI model.
Does MemU use embedding-based retrieval?
No, MemU uses non-embedding LLM-based search retrieval, reading memory category files directly and enabling semantic traceability.
What is the pricing model for MemU?
MemU is freemium with contact-based pricing, likely token-based. No fixed monthly plans are publicly listed.
Can Spider Cloud handle anti-bot measures?
Yes, Spider Cloud includes a Browser Cloud with stealth anti-detection and an /ai/unblocker endpoint for unblocking sites with aggressive anti-bot measures.
